The Division of Health AI builds machine learning models that run inside Northwell Health, from early-warning systems at the hospital bedside to decoders for vagus nerve signals. The work combines computational neuroscience, clinical medicine, and software engineering.

Machine learning built inside the hospital system it runs in.

The work is done with the clinicians who will use it, on Northwell’s own records. The deterioration model already runs in silent mode inside the hospitals’ Epic system.

What the lab has built

Four programs built inside Northwell, each with published results.

Clinical AI

Patient deterioration prediction

A wearable-based deep learning model, published in Nature Communications, flags in-hospital deterioration up to 17 hours before onset from just nine physiological signals. Supported by a $3.1M NIH grant, it anticipates rapid response calls, ICU transfers, and other adverse outcomes.

Pandemic Response

COVID-19 clinical decision support

Machine learning tools developed during the pandemic to support clinical decisions for COVID-19 patients, drawing on tens of thousands of cases across multiple cohorts. Published in JAMA and Nature Communications.

Bioelectronic Medicine

Vagus nerve digital twin

High-resolution 3D reconstructions of 60 human vagus nerves segmented from hundreds of terabytes of imaging data using nn-U-Net. Part of a $6.7M NIH SPARC award.

Operational AI

Workforce forecasting

DeepAR probabilistic forecasting of nursing demand at 12-month horizons across Northwell's hospital units, supporting preemptive staffing decisions.
